The H!Fiber 10G Single Mode SFP+ LC Module is a high-performance 10GBase-LR fiber transceiver designed for professional-grade networking. Supporting 10Gbps speeds over single-mode fiber up to 10km, it offers broad compatibility with major brands like Cisco, Meraki, and Ubiquiti. Featuring plug-and-play hot-swappable design, advanced digital diagnostic monitoring, and low power consumption under 1.05W, this 4-pack ensures reliable, energy-efficient connectivity backed by 3 years warranty and lifetime tech support.

Only semi-compatible with Intel based 82599EN adapter. Random disconnects every few minutes
SFP+ transceiver connected and obtained a good speed throughput, but random Network Link disconnects happened every few minutes with Windows 10 (with updated Intel drivers version 27), thus causing intermittent disconnects to other resources. I replaced with another set of transceivers and they worked flawless without disconnects on same endpoint devices.

flaky with ubiquiti xg 6 poe switches at short distance
i tried these with 0.5m patch fiber and ubiquiti xg 6 poe switches, udm pro se, and aggregation switch at each end; performance was ok at first but them links degraded with sub 1gbit performance in one direction and the cages were hotter than expected; they were also hard to remove and one broke apart while being pulled out of a slot; replacing these with multimode sfp+ transceivers and pacth fiber from ubiquiti
